Walk through northern Kraainem
This walk focuses on the northern part of the municipality, where Kraainem originated.
We set off from St Pancratius Church, first visiting ‘High-Kraainem’ and the Jourdain area, before walking via the Kleine Maalbeek river to ‘Low-Kraainem’ and the river Woluwe. Water and – in this case – the old Roman road, with its passage through the area, ensured that a residential centre emerged which was reasonably well-populated. We assume the existence of a maintained ford, through which traders and travellers could pass, as well.
With the help of historical maps, old photographs and postcards, we will bring the past to life and discuss the steps that led to the current street plan.
Guided tour of St Pancratius Church and St Anthony’s Church
A tour inside two listed buildings, symbols of tradition and innovation.
In St Pancratius, church, with its Romanesque tower, Gothic choir and nave completed in 1770, you will be taken on a journey through the centuries.
St Anthony’s Parish takes you back to the vibrant atmosphere of Expo ’58 and ‘Joyful Belgium’: in 1958, this chapel epitomised futuristic architecture.
Guided tour of the Henri-Jaspar Residence
The Henri-Jaspar Institute is situated right on the border between Kraainem and Tervuren. This building was originally conceived as a sanatorium for children in poor health. Discover Kraainem was invited to present its rich historyon the occasion of its completed renovation. Guided tours of this private site are still organised on a regular basis.
A walk through the Bouvier-Washer garden district
Join a bilingual guided tour to discover the Bouvier-Washer garden district from a new perspective, based on recent archival discoveries.
This neighbourhood of 40 cottage-style houses, designed by the architect Fernand Delbrassinne, was built in 1923–1924 and provided accommodation for soldiers disabled in the Great War. It bears the marks of tragic events, bears witness to a philanthropic impulse and revives the memory of an eventful family history.
Guided tour of the Visitation Convent
The Visitation Convent on the Hebronlaan in Kraainem is an architecturally fascinating building. Discover Kraainem has already been granted special permission by the owners on several occasions to organise guided tours in 2023 and 2025.
